RED J ENVIRONMENTAL CORPORATION Government Contract #127EAX26C0017
RED J ENVIRONMENTAL CORPORATION was awarded a contract with the United States Government for $7,245.48. The contract was awarded by the agency office USDA-FS, CSA SOUTHWEST 7, which is a division with the Forest Service within the Department of Agriculture.
Summary of Award
The recipient of the federal contract is RED J ENVIRONMENTAL CORPORATION, a U.S.-owned small business located in Joseph City, Arizona. The contract, funded by the Department of Agriculture, Forest Service, Coconino National Forest, is for selective demolition, mold abatement, treatment, and follow-up testing, with a total obligation of $7,245.48. The contract was not competed and was awarded on an urgent basis. No notable financial transactions are documented in the list.
